CDARS®

Certificate of Deposit Account Registry Service®, or CDARS®, is a service that allows USAmeriBank to provide customers with access to full FDIC insurance on CD investments up to $50 million. USAmeriBank is part of a network of banks that allows us to place funds into CDs issued by other banks in the network. Both principal and interest are eligible for FDIC coverage. The customer will receive one statement from USAmeriBank summarizing all of the CDARS® holdings.

Health Savings Account

A Health Savings Account (HSA), is a tax-advantaged medical savings account available to people who are enrolled in High Deductible Health Plans (HDHP). The funds contributed to the account may be tax deductible. Unlike a Flexible Savings Account (FSA), funds roll over and accumulate year after year if not spent.

Funds may be used to pay for qualified medical expenses at any time. These include deductibles, co-payments and co-insurance; procedures, testing, dental, vision and chiropractic care; durable medical equipment including eyeglasses and hearing aids; and medical transportation. Prescription and over-the-counter medications are also eligible. More information on eligible expenses may be found on the IRS website.
